Info | "According to an article in the Minneapolis Star Tribune, October 19, 1987, in 1987-88 he was tired of the 'repetitive nature' of the biographical section of the Legislative Manuals. So he wrote that he 'runs Tundra Guides and Outfitters, guiding photographers on Kodiak bear trips in northwestern Alaska. He runs and nurtures Quinn's Botanical Gardens, world-famous for their strains of rare black tulips.' In reality he was still an attorney who had never been to Alaska."
